Ticket: Staging env misconfigured for Siftgate bloom filter

The bloom layer in front of the Pellet KV store is rejecting all lookups in staging because the env file was copied from the dev template without credentials. False-positive tuning values are fine; only the auth line is missing. To unblock the weekly demo, the Pellet admission secret must be set on the following line.

env line for yaguf-fajop: LEDGER_TOKEN13=fb08984397349

## Changelog — Tidemark Widget 3.2

Defaults changed. Read before touching anything.

- Refresh interval now hourly, not every 15 min. Harbor feeds from the Pellisport aggregator throttle aggressive polling.
- Lunar-offset correction is on by default. Disable only for legacy Kestrel Bay deployments.
- Chart units default to metric. The imperial fallback flag is deprecated and will be removed in 3.4.
- Cache eviction is now time-based, not size-based.

New installs should start from the default configuration values listed below.

config for kahap-taweg:
oliox:
  pin: 8609
  tenant: casath
  seal: seal_632a4a6f
  metrics_host: metrics.oliox.nelvrogrid.example
  standby_team: keleth
  escalation: briiel-oliwyn
  nonce: e2397c

Ticket VL-2281: Vault locked during encoding-detection rollout. While deploying the charset-sniffing update for uploaded text files on Brindlework, the Corvette vault sealed itself after three failed unlock attempts by the deploy job. The detection service now falls back to UTF-8, which masks the issue but blocks release sign-off. Marisol from platform confirmed the vault must be manually recovered before the 4.2 cut. For the release manager: unlock using the recovery passphrase below.

unlock words, yagag-yahog: gordor-zorvan-druius-queniel-normir-norwyn-framir-novmir-ralius-holwyn-wenwyn-tamael-silok-holdor